The Gorgon's Gaze

Upon the desolate plains of Greece resided Medusa, a creature of terrible fascination. Her gaze, a curse of petrification, struck terror into the hearts of any who dared approach. The ground beneath her feet was littered with shattered armor and broken swords, a testament to Medusa's reign of terror.

One day, a hero named Perseus was tasked with slaying this monstrous Gorgon. Armed with a mirrored shield, Perseus embarked on a perilous journey to confront Medusa in her lair.
